The Takata Air Bag Recall: A Wake-Up Call for Automotive Safety

For over a decade, drivers and passengers across the United States, Canada, Europe, Asia, and Australia lived with an invisible threat inside their vehicles—defective air bags manufactured by Takata Corporation. What began as isolated reports of air bag inflator ruptures escalated into the largest automotive recall in history, ultimately affecting more than 100 million vehicles worldwide. At its core, this crisis exposed profound customer pain points rooted in uncertainty, vulnerability, and eroded trust—not just in one supplier, but in the entire automotive safety ecosystem.
Customers faced mounting anxiety each time they entered their cars. Was their vehicle among the tens of millions flagged for recall? Had the repair been completed correctly—or at all? Many owners received multiple recall notices over several years, only to find dealerships out of parts or facing indefinite wait times. Others discovered their cars were no longer covered under warranty for replacement, leaving them to shoulder unexpected costs. Worse still, some consumers unknowingly drove vehicles with air bags containing ammonium nitrate propellant—a compound highly sensitive to heat and humidity—that could explode upon deployment, propelling metal shrapnel into the cabin. Tragically, at least 27 deaths and hundreds of injuries have been linked to these failures. The emotional toll was real: parents worried about children’s safety, fleet managers questioned liability exposure, and used-car buyers hesitated before purchasing even lightly driven models. Confidence in manufacturer promises—and in regulatory oversight—suffered irreparable damage.
